Sacred Harp Iowa All-Day Sing

Saturday, April 2, from 10:00 a.m. to 4:00 p.m. Sacred Harp or “shape-note” singing traces its roots back to 1844. Notes are defined shapes and thus aid in the learning of the music. Patrons sit in the round. There is no set leader and the group members take turns leading. This creates a marvelous musical style. Join us for all day or a few minutes. Per tradition, there will be a pot-luck “dinner on the grounds” in Westminster Hall at noon.

Arts in Worship Programs The Rutter Requiem

Friday, March 25, at 7:00 p. m. In the Sanctuary Join us on Good Friday for a special presentation of John Rutter’s haunting and beautiful setting of The Requiem. A blend of the Anglican Book of Common Prayer, the Psalms, and the Requiem Mass, Rutter’s music is a fitting tribute to Christ’s loving sacrifice.
